Output 170043f172263eec35607264e6a90dd5e0822b244eb908eb0b98b83192aa855f:1

value
88328122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f621c7c2f1ff0d15279ce2acbfaf390096bda854 OP_EQUAL
address
3Q8ScqC7N4BWpSUEdAi1bZxwBe8gm8tJgi
transaction
170043f172263eec35607264e6a90dd5e0822b244eb908eb0b98b83192aa855f
confirmations
417738
spent
true